Larsen and Toubro Technology Services (LTTS) has partnered with NVIDIA to develop software-defined architectures for medical devices, focusing on endoscopy. The collaboration aims to address challenges related to the availability, cost, and dependencies of custom and proprietary hardware components in the medical industry. The scalable platform supports multiple applications, offering real-time decision-making tools for medical professionals. The architecture includes AI/ML models for the detection and classification of polyps found during colonoscopies. Leveraging NVIDIA Holoscan and NVIDIA IGX Orin platforms, the collaboration aims to enhance image quality and support AI-based decision-making in medical imaging.
